Chhamna is a Village located in the Taluka of Mayureswar - II, in the district of Birbhum district, in the state of West Bengal state with a total population of 1727. There are 477 houses in the Village.

Chhamna Population by Sex

There are total of 881 male persons and 846 females and a total number of 206 children below 6 years in Chhamna.
The percentage of male population is 51.01%.
The percentage of female population is 48.99%.
The percentage of child population is 11.93%.
